WHEN North Durham teenager John Caulfield became the first member of his family to fly he did it with a difference - with no engine.

John, 14, an air cadet from Stanley, experienced three launches in a Viking glider while visiting 645 Volunteer Gliding School, based at Catterick Garrison, North Yorkshire. "It is really weird when you leave the ground for the first time," said John, who plans to visit RAF Leeming, also North Yorkshire, to fly in an RAF light aircraft, and eventually hopes to join the Raf.

John was accompanied on his trip by cadets Simon Critchlow, 14, and John Lister, 15, of 1409 Consett Squadron,

The Consett squadron meets on Monday and Friday evenings at its Parliament Street headquarters.
